Norton advised me of a Trojan in C:\windows\system32\msurl\32.exe. I did a
virus check in safe mode and it found three instances of it which it could
not clean so I took the option to quarantine them. Now when I reboot I get a
message saying that the (now quarantined) file cannot be found and to make
sure that it exists or to remove it from the registry. Is this a file that I
need to re-install from somewhere or can I safely delete the registry
reference, if I can find it.

Run hijackthis and note the entries under category 04,
you should be able to delete the key with the "fix checked" option.
